Should I travel with a 5 month old to Punta Cana? |
My family and I are planning a trip to Punta Cana, my pediatrician told me it's fine because I will be breast feeding. On the other hand my family doctor says it's best not to go there, that I should go to Florida or Cuba instead. Can you give me your opinion on if I should go or if anyone has traveled with a 5 month old? |

I can only speak from my experience; I have personally travel with my two girls since their birth (I go every year with my 6 and 2 year old) to Punta Cana/Santo Domingo and had no problems with them getting sick, thanks God! However you will need to be careful as any mother would with the things your baby gets in his/her mouth and make sure you wash anything you give him/her with purified water instead of tap water. Bring mosquito repellant just in case you need it when you are there (depends on the season) but other than that you should be able to enjoy your stay at any resort in Punta Cana. Trust me, you won’t regret a bit! |

I think is safe for your family and your baby go to Punta Cana. Punta Cana is a resort area, family friendly, there are some clinics available for tourists and some resorts has a doctor available. There is no reason for believe that your baby going to be get sick, just take precautions, such as carrying sunscreen for babies and mosquito repellent. Some hotels also have nannies available that can be contracted by hours or by days and maybe one time enjoy the nightlife.
I am mother of two, I went with my children and we enjoyed too much. |
